GROWTH OF TECHNICAL SCHOOLS

MOKE ACCOATMODATfON WANTED. At yesterday's conference of directors ami supervisors of technical schools (ho. chairman, Mr. George, had something to say about the necessity for increased accommodation for technical classes throughout the Dominion. Bβ said that it wo~uld be necessnry for Parliament togrant a big appropriation for the buildings and equipment required- to carry on more satisfactorily the. present work, and also the work that would* come if tho recommendations of the conference were brought into force. A. resolution was needed to draw attention to the fact that everywhere more accommodation was required. -Mr. l'osscy. I think it is not so much a question of present necessities on the present scale of the teebnical school work in tho Dominion but of provision of adequate menus of instruction in nil phases on the senie which is adopted iit other countries.

The following resolution was passed: "That the National Efficiency Board should urge upon the Government the necessity for allocating sufficient funds to provide for the erection, equipment, and upkeep of technical schools throughout the Dominion on modern lines, lo meet; Hie increased demand that must arise for technical education, and must be supplied if our industries lire to be di'veloned so n- lo satisfy our national needs."
